Отдельное приращение для Tensorflow global_step с помощью Estimator API - PullRequest
0 голосов
/ 14 мая 2018

опять у меня вопрос по поводу Tensorflow. По разным причинам я хочу, чтобы переменная представляла не количество шагов, выполненных оптимизатором, а количество обработанных выборок (что соответствовало бы шагам оптимизатора в случае batchsize = 1).

Я думаю, что лучше всего использовать переменную global_step, потому что она уже существует и автоматически загружается / сохраняется API Estimator. Есть ли возможность динамически указывать размер приращения или есть способ добиться того же поведения сохранения / восстановления с помощью только что созданной переменной?

Важна совместимость с API Tensorflow Estimator.

- Изменить для уточнения причины

Я хочу поэкспериментировать с изменением размеров пакетов во время экспериментов. Обычно это возможно с Tensorflow. Размеры пакетов варьируются динамически, поэтому простое вычисление / сумма значений будет невозможна

-

Большое спасибо заранее

...